## Break-Glass Access: Fixtureloom Test-Data Factory

Fixtureloom seeds deterministic test data across our staging environments. If the seeding vault becomes unreachable and CI is blocked, new team members should follow the break-glass procedure rather than regenerating factories by hand. Confirm with your onboarding buddy first, then open the emergency unlock panel in the Fixtureloom console. The panel will prompt for the recovery passphrase shown below.

vault phrase of kawep-tahog = ulaix-briath

Memo to Finance Team — Quillbase Plus Tier

Quillbase Plus launches next cycle. Price point set above standard tier; billing codes to be created this week. Revenue recognised monthly, no deferrals. Expect migration of roughly a fifth of existing accounts. Forecast templates updated by Dasha Morrell. Rationale for the pricing is covered in the confidential note below.

internal memo for yahag-tahog: The pricing group signed off on a budget of $152.8 million for Project Soriel.

Ticket FV-2093: The Larkspool transcoding farm rejected batch 77 because the worker manifest failed signature verification after the scheduler upgrade. We confirmed the artifact hash is intact; the failure traces to a stale trust anchor on node group C. For your review, the signing key currently in rotation follows.

signing key of bagap-yawep = bky13_TbfT6ZMUoGJo2

### Action Item: Spoolhaven Retry Storm

From last Tuesday's outage: the Spoolhaven print service retried failed jobs without backoff, saturating the render pool. Fix merged; retries now use capped exponential backoff with jitter. Owner will monitor for a week before closing. The agreed retry constants are recorded below.

constants for yadup-kajof:
RATE_LIMITS = {
    "zorwyn": 1,
    "druwyn": 1,
}